Django는 웹 애플리케이션에 맞춘 도구를 갖춘 내장 테스트 프레임워크(Python의 unittest 확장)를 포함합니다—요청을 시뮬레이션하는 테스트 클라이언트, 격리된 테스트 데이터베이스를 생성하는 픽스처/데이터베이스 시스템, model/view/form 테스트를 위한 헬퍼입니다.
기본 테스트 케이스
django.test TestCase
():
():
.article = Article.objects.create(title=, body=)
():
.assertEqual((.article), )
():
.assertFalse(.article.published)
